價(jià)格通常介于幾萬至數(shù)十萬不等。對(duì)于應(yīng)用程序的開發(fā)價(jià)格,主要取決于以下幾個(gè)關(guān)鍵因素:
一、應(yīng)用程序開發(fā)的功能需求
應(yīng)用程序的功能需求直接決定了開發(fā)成本。功能簡單,人力成本較低,價(jià)格相對(duì)較低;而如果功能復(fù)雜,開發(fā)難度加大,價(jià)格自然上升。在咨詢應(yīng)用程序開發(fā)價(jià)格前,首先要明確您希望開發(fā)的APP類型及其功能板塊。

二、應(yīng)用程序開發(fā)技術(shù)的影響
APP開發(fā)技術(shù)可分為原生開發(fā)、Web開發(fā)和混合開發(fā)三種類型。
1. 原生開發(fā):利用蘋果iOS系統(tǒng)官方推出的編程工具進(jìn)行開發(fā),所開發(fā)的APP功能強(qiáng)大,性能優(yōu)越,反應(yīng)速度快。但開發(fā)過程需要較多的人力、時(shí)間和資源,因此成本較高。
2. Web開發(fā):主要使用H5網(wǎng)頁技術(shù)進(jìn)行APP軟件開發(fā),相當(dāng)于開發(fā)網(wǎng)頁版后加入APP外殼。這種開發(fā)方式功能相對(duì)較少,性能可能稍遜,但開發(fā)團(tuán)隊(duì)需求較小,速度快,成本較低。
3. 混合開發(fā):部分采用原生開發(fā),部分采用其他技術(shù),但目前該技術(shù)尚不成熟,市場缺乏相應(yīng)的開發(fā)人才。

注意事項(xiàng):
1. 了解用戶:APP開發(fā)需根據(jù)用戶需求進(jìn)行功能設(shè)計(jì),結(jié)合目標(biāo)用戶的特征。APP的運(yùn)營也要圍繞用戶興趣點(diǎn)進(jìn)行。
2. 目標(biāo)導(dǎo)向的設(shè)計(jì)規(guī)劃:在開發(fā)APP前,要明確目標(biāo),結(jié)合用戶體驗(yàn)流程、業(yè)務(wù)流程等進(jìn)行細(xì)化。每個(gè)APP都應(yīng)根據(jù)目標(biāo)用戶的核心需求開發(fā)出核心功能。
關(guān)于開發(fā)一個(gè)安卓手機(jī)APP需要多少錢的問題,實(shí)際上,價(jià)格的計(jì)算公式相當(dāng)簡單:所需人力×開發(fā)周期。一個(gè)簡單的APP可能包含iOS端、Android端、管理后臺(tái)等版本,復(fù)雜的項(xiàng)目還可能涉及微信公眾號(hào)、微信小程序、PC端等不同版本。
以最簡單的版本為例,開發(fā)一個(gè)APP需要涉及產(chǎn)品經(jīng)理、UI設(shè)計(jì)師、開發(fā)工程師和測試工程師。其中,產(chǎn)品經(jīng)理負(fù)責(zé)確定APP的功能和交互設(shè)計(jì),UI設(shè)計(jì)師則負(fù)責(zé)APP界面設(shè)計(jì),開發(fā)工程師則進(jìn)行實(shí)際編碼工作,而測試工程師則確保APP的質(zhì)量和穩(wěn)定性。每一個(gè)環(huán)節(jié)都至關(guān)重要,共同決定了APP的開發(fā)周期和最終價(jià)格。

設(shè)計(jì)一個(gè)好的APP原型是項(xiàng)目流程的第一步,它有助于確定開發(fā)時(shí)間、報(bào)價(jià)以及團(tuán)隊(duì)內(nèi)部的溝通。而UI設(shè)計(jì)師的工作則關(guān)乎APP的外觀設(shè)計(jì),一個(gè)優(yōu)秀的UI設(shè)計(jì)師能大大提升APP的用戶體驗(yàn)。開發(fā)工程師是整個(gè)項(xiàng)目的核心,他們負(fù)責(zé)將設(shè)計(jì)轉(zhuǎn)化為實(shí)際可用的APP。了解這些角色和他們的職責(zé)有助于更好地理解APP開發(fā)的復(fù)雜性和所需成本。技術(shù)架構(gòu)決定人員配置:深度解析當(dāng)前APP開發(fā)方式及其影響
隨著技術(shù)的發(fā)展,移動(dòng)APP的開發(fā)方式多種多樣,這些不同的技術(shù)架構(gòu)不僅影響APP的最終體驗(yàn),開發(fā)周期,還決定著開發(fā)團(tuán)隊(duì)的人員配置。本文將詳細(xì)解析當(dāng)前存在的幾種主流開發(fā)方式,包括原生態(tài)APP、React Native(Weex) APP、混合開發(fā)APP以及web頁面套殼APP,并探討測試工程師的角色以及項(xiàng)目成本。
一、原生態(tài)APP
原生態(tài)APP采用傳統(tǒng)的開發(fā)模式,ios使用原生的xcode objective-c編寫,安卓使用android studio java語言進(jìn)行編寫。其優(yōu)勢(shì)在于性能好,頁面流暢。開發(fā)成本和維護(hù)成本較高,開發(fā)效率相對(duì)較低。bug修復(fù)后需要審核,目前ios和android的審核周期都在3天以內(nèi)。人員配比方面,需要相當(dāng)比例的ios、android以及后端開發(fā)人員。
二、React Native(Weex) APP

React Native(Weex)技術(shù)的出現(xiàn)旨在解決原生開發(fā)的成本及效率問題。其原理是使用js編寫一套代碼,控制原生的app組件運(yùn)行。該框架性能穩(wěn)定,社區(qū)活躍。優(yōu)勢(shì)在于性能與原生app相當(dāng),而開發(fā)、維護(hù)成本遠(yuǎn)低于原生app,可以一套代碼支持ios、android平臺(tái)。劣勢(shì)在于學(xué)習(xí)成本較高,需要了解原生開發(fā)的人員。人員配比以前端和后端為主。
三、混合開發(fā)APP
混合開發(fā)技術(shù)也是為了解決原生app的成本及效率問題。其原理是使用web的形式編寫頁面內(nèi)容,通過js控制內(nèi)容在webview中顯示。優(yōu)勢(shì)在于開發(fā)、維護(hù)成本較低。性能較差,體驗(yàn)不夠流暢,且穩(wěn)定性、問題解決方面得不到很好的保證,因此尚未有大型app采用這種方式。
四、web頁面套殼
web套殼指的是將已開發(fā)好的H5頁面嵌入到APP中。其優(yōu)勢(shì)在于成本最低,一套H5代碼可服務(wù)于android、ios、微信端。性能較差,若為全H5頁面,在與原生app交互時(shí)會(huì)較為麻煩,局限性較高。

五、測試工程師的角色
測試工程師在項(xiàng)目中的中后期參與,主要進(jìn)行黑盒測試,確保APP的質(zhì)量和功能。他們?cè)谡麄€(gè)項(xiàng)目中起著至關(guān)重要的作用,能夠及時(shí)發(fā)現(xiàn)并反饋問題,幫助團(tuán)隊(duì)提升產(chǎn)品質(zhì)量。
六、項(xiàng)目成本
假設(shè)一個(gè)項(xiàng)目的周期為兩個(gè)月,企業(yè)除了支付員工的月薪外,還需要承擔(dān)額外的支出如五險(xiǎn)一金、辦公室租金等。在估算項(xiàng)目成本時(shí),除了考慮員工的薪資,還需考慮這些額外支出。日薪一般按照每月工作22.5天計(jì)算。
技術(shù)架構(gòu)的選擇將決定人員配置、開發(fā)成本、開發(fā)周期以及APP的最終體驗(yàn)。企業(yè)在選擇開發(fā)方式時(shí),需綜合考慮自身需求、預(yù)算、時(shí)間等因素,做出最合理的決策。以下是偽原創(chuàng)后的內(nèi)容:

角色薪酬與支出概覽:
角色:產(chǎn)品經(jīng)理
月薪:1.5萬
企業(yè)支出:2.1萬
平均日薪:約933元

投入時(shí)間:每月投入約10天
總支出(按月薪計(jì)算):約9333元
角色:UI設(shè)計(jì)師
月薪:1.2萬
企業(yè)支出:約每月投入約一萬六千八千元

平均日薪:約747元(按月薪計(jì)算)
投入時(shí)間:每月投入約15天
總支出:約一萬兩千元(以平均日薪計(jì)算)總投入成本約每月十一萬兩千元。此角色在項(xiàng)目中的重要性不言而喻,所以支出也相對(duì)較大。由于設(shè)計(jì)工作相對(duì)集中,投入時(shí)間也較長。他們的工作成果直接影響到產(chǎn)品的用戶體驗(yàn)和品牌形象。他們?cè)趫F(tuán)隊(duì)中扮演著橋梁的角色,需要與產(chǎn)品經(jīng)理緊密合作,確保設(shè)計(jì)符合產(chǎn)品方向和用戶習(xí)慣。他們的工作也需要高度的創(chuàng)造性和想象力,以確保產(chǎn)品的視覺吸引力。他們的薪資和支出也是團(tuán)隊(duì)中相對(duì)較高的??傮w來說,他們的支出與其重要性和專業(yè)性相匹配。角色:安卓工程師月薪為1萬五千元企業(yè)每月為此職位投入的費(fèi)用為兩萬零一千元日平均收入為三百七十三元左右在項(xiàng)目開發(fā)周期內(nèi)(假定為兩個(gè)月),平均每天投入工作時(shí)長為八小時(shí)以上,總投入成本約為三萬兩千六百六十六元。作為安卓工程師,他們需要具備扎實(shí)的編程基礎(chǔ)和豐富的實(shí)戰(zhàn)經(jīng)驗(yàn),以確保開發(fā)的順利進(jìn)行。他們的工作涉及到系統(tǒng)的穩(wěn)定性和性能優(yōu)化等方面,因此需要具備高度的責(zé)任心和敬業(yè)精神。他們也需要不斷學(xué)習(xí)和更新自己的知識(shí)庫,以適應(yīng)不斷變化的市場需求和安卓系統(tǒng)的更新迭代。角色:iOS工程師、前端工程師和后端工程師的薪酬和支出情況與安卓工程師相似。他們的職責(zé)也各有不同,但都是項(xiàng)目中不可或缺的角色。測試工程師的月薪較低,但企業(yè)支出也相對(duì)較少。他們的職責(zé)是確保產(chǎn)品的質(zhì)量,需要細(xì)心和耐心,以確保產(chǎn)品的穩(wěn)定性和用戶體驗(yàn)。原生開發(fā)項(xiàng)目的總支出大約為十三萬五千元。而其他模式的項(xiàng)目總支出則在十萬二千元左右浮動(dòng)。對(duì)于一個(gè)開發(fā)周期約為兩個(gè)月的項(xiàng)目來說,除了以上的人員支出外,還需要考慮到其他方面的支出如項(xiàng)目間隔、推廣營銷等隱性開支綜合因素最終會(huì)形成一個(gè)總價(jià)格區(qū)間大概在十二萬到二十萬之間不同的項(xiàng)目需求和團(tuán)隊(duì)規(guī)模也會(huì)影響到這個(gè)總價(jià)格區(qū)間內(nèi)的具體數(shù)值以上信息可以作為企業(yè)在預(yù)算和招聘時(shí)的重要參考依據(jù)幫助企業(yè)更好地管理成本和人力資源分配以及招聘人才的精準(zhǔn)度以確保項(xiàng)目的順利進(jìn)行和團(tuán)隊(duì)的穩(wěn)定性與高效性為公司帶來更大的價(jià)值同時(shí)也要注意不同職位之間的工作職責(zé)和薪酬差異以制定更為合理的人力資源管理策略以更好地推動(dòng)企業(yè)的發(fā)展和項(xiàng)目落地為公司創(chuàng)造更多的商業(yè)價(jià)值和社會(huì)效益從而不斷提高企業(yè)的競爭力和市場份額從而不斷滿足市場和用戶的需求贏得更多的商業(yè)機(jī)會(huì)和市場認(rèn)可。